The name most associated with the job is Ken Jennings. His streak in 2004 remains the gold standard for quiz show dominance. That run lasted 74 games and earned over $2.5 million. To put that in perspective, most contestants walk away with a trip to the airport gift shop and a story. Jennings walked away with a new identity as a celebrity.
The Salary Behind the Podium
Hosting a daily network show pays a consistent salary. Unlike a movie role, a TV gig has a contract. For a long time, the emcee earned a steady, six-figure sum. That steady income builds wealth quietly. It is not a splashy headline number, but it forms the bedrock.
Then came the syndication deal. Jeopardy! expanded its reach massively. When a show airs in hundreds of markets, the talent pool gets deeper pay. The host now commands a significant annual salary. Combined with residuals from reruns, the math adds up fast.
Beyond the Buzzing Light
A jeopardy host net worth figure should include other ventures. Jennings writes for publication. He authored books that sit on shelves across the country. His dry wit translates perfectly from the screen to the printed page. These projects generate independent royalties.
He also speaks at corporate events. A corporate speech fee for a famous personality runs high. Factor in podcast guesting and licensing deals for his likeness. The income streams multiply when the public recognizes you.

The Real Cost of Laughter Lines
Hosting requires sharp mental reflexes. The job looks easy from the couch. In reality, the person behind the podium must track every response. They manage pacing, cue cards, and live audio. It is a technical performance masked as casual conversation.
